CHAPTER 643.
AN ACT to add a section to the Code of Public Local Laws
of Maryland. Article 11, title, "Frederick County," as
codified by George R. Dennis, Jr., sub-title. "Sheriff,"
regulating certain fees, expenses and mileage of the Sher-
iff of Frederick County, to be known as Section 704-A.
SECTION 1. Be it enacted by the General Assembly of
Maryland., That an additional section be and the same is
hereby added to the Code of Public Local Laws of Maryland,
Article 11. title, "Frederick County," as codified by George
R. Dennis, Jr.. sub-title, "Sheriff," to follow after Section
704, to be known as Section 704-A, and to read as follows:
SEC. 704-A. The Sheriff of Frederick County shall receive
for serving a warrant or for making ati arrest, either in per-
son or by deputy, in addition to the fee of seventy-five cents
now allowed by law, the sum of ten cents per mile for every
mile necessary to be traveled, and shall receive the actual
expenses of transportation of said prisoner or prisoners mid
the custodian thereof.
Approved April 23, 1920.
